aboutsummaryrefslogtreecommitdiffstats
path: root/firmware
diff options
context:
space:
mode:
authorClifford Wolf <clifford@clifford.at>2015-11-20 16:45:09 +0100
committerClifford Wolf <clifford@clifford.at>2015-11-20 16:45:09 +0100
commit5953e57899663cf555b2b14cf3234c013f9bb2ee (patch)
tree17c5e77104e27549bdfce099256272d47287a419 /firmware
parentf8eed23a687b3f3da19588bed4b4e85e46fcb330 (diff)
downloadpicorv32-5953e57899663cf555b2b14cf3234c013f9bb2ee.tar.gz
picorv32-5953e57899663cf555b2b14cf3234c013f9bb2ee.zip
Towards compressed ISA support
Diffstat (limited to 'firmware')
-rw-r--r--firmware/irq.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/firmware/irq.c b/firmware/irq.c
index 5a7ec27..a387524 100644
--- a/firmware/irq.c
+++ b/firmware/irq.c
@@ -38,7 +38,7 @@ uint32_t *irq(uint32_t *regs, uint32_t irqs)
print_str("------------------------------------------------------------\n");
if ((irqs & 2) != 0) {
- if (instr == 0x00100073) {
+ if (instr == 0x00100073 || (instr & 0xffff) == 9002) {
print_str("SBREAK instruction at 0x");
print_hex(pc, 8);
print_str("\n");